Ludhiana February 22A five-day training course on “Food Preservation” jointly organised by the Department of Extension Education and the Skill Development Centre concluded at Punjab Agricultural University (PAU).
The course was held at Beela village in Pakhowal block Ludhiana under the entrepreneurship programme for scheduled castes.
As many as 30 farm women attended the training course which aimed at imparting entrepreneurial skills needed for running a particular venture.
Dr Dharminder Singh Senior Extension Scientist urged the farm women to unite and form self-help groups for empowerment.
Dr Parkash Singh Agriculture Officer explained different schemes being offered by the department to the farmers and farm women.
